Sump Pump Plumbing in Boston, MA
Sump pump plumbing services focus on the installation, repair, and maintenance of sump pumps-devices designed to remove excess water from basements and crawl spaces. These services typically cover projects such as installing new sump pumps, upgrading existing systems, and addressing issues like pump failures or flooding caused by heavy rain or melting snow. Property owners often want to understand how a sump pump works, the signs indicating it may need repairs, and the benefits of proper installation to prevent water damage and mold growth in their homes.
Before requesting sump pump plumbing services, homeowners should consider factors like the size of their property, the level of water risk in their area, and the type of sump pump best suited for their needs. It’s also helpful to know if the existing system requires repairs or replacement, and whether additional drainage solutions are necessary to ensure effective water removal. Clear information about these aspects can support informed decisions and help ensure the sump pump functions reliably during heavy storms or seasonal changes.

Sump Pump Plumbing Questions
What is a sump pump and how does it work? A sump pump is a device installed in the basement or crawl space to remove excess water, preventing flooding and water damage during heavy rains or snowmelt.
When should a sump pump be replaced? Replacement is recommended if the pump frequently cycles on and off, makes unusual noises, or fails to remove water effectively.
What are common signs of sump pump failure? Signs include persistent flooding, strange noises, or the pump running constantly without removing water.
Can a sump pump be installed in an existing basement? Yes, sump pumps can be added to existing basements to improve drainage and prevent water issues.
